My inspection report missed a major roof issue... found out during the final walkthrough

I was doing the final walkthrough on my condo in Tampa last month, right before closing. The inspector had said the roof was 'fine for its age' but during a heavy rain that morning, I saw water dripping from a bedroom ceiling light fixture. I called a roofer friend who came over and found a section of flashing completely rusted through under the shingles. We had to delay closing by two weeks and got the seller to put $5,000 into an escrow account to fix it. Has anyone else had an inspector miss something that big, and what did you do?

Our inspector missed a cracked heat exchanger in the furnace. We hired a specialist for a second opinion and used their report to negotiate a credit at closing. Getting that expert look saved us from a huge safety hazard later on.
